[clang] 1e3dc8c - [Serialization] Fix a warning

Kazu Hirata via cfe-commits cfe-commits at lists.llvm.org
Fri Aug 23 05:49:55 PDT 2024


Author: Kazu Hirata
Date: 2024-08-23T05:49:49-07:00
New Revision: 1e3dc8cdb49bf7b8344d1d7f7befbb95a9fbdb63

URL: https://github.com/llvm/llvm-project/commit/1e3dc8cdb49bf7b8344d1d7f7befbb95a9fbdb63
DIFF: https://github.com/llvm/llvm-project/commit/1e3dc8cdb49bf7b8344d1d7f7befbb95a9fbdb63.diff

LOG: [Serialization] Fix a warning

This patch fixes:

  clang/lib/Serialization/ASTReader.cpp:9978:27: error: lambda capture
  'this' is not used [-Werror,-Wunused-lambda-capture]

Added: 
    

Modified: 
    clang/lib/Serialization/ASTReader.cpp

Removed: 
    


################################################################################
diff  --git a/clang/lib/Serialization/ASTReader.cpp b/clang/lib/Serialization/ASTReader.cpp
index be83805f1e92b9..ffdaec4067e1c4 100644
--- a/clang/lib/Serialization/ASTReader.cpp
+++ b/clang/lib/Serialization/ASTReader.cpp
@@ -9975,7 +9975,7 @@ void ASTReader::finishPendingActions() {
       return false;
     };
 
-    auto hasDefinition = [this, &hasDefinitionImpl](Decl *D) {
+    auto hasDefinition = [&hasDefinitionImpl](Decl *D) {
       return hasDefinitionImpl(D, hasDefinitionImpl);
     };
 


        


More information about the cfe-commits mailing list